Transaction 252e6830d9b42d88e230eac8fef0eea24ebee645b1d8ca006a7dbf05674f93ba

block
f1c9f7adec33e8ba886f9ea16b27570fac514eaf956c3e3985462ea4523d44b7

1 Input

23 Outputs